Description
In Genoa, you'll take on the role of a Renaissance trader, navigating the city to acquire goods and fill orders. But you won't be doing it alone - negotiation and deal-making are key to success. With the ability to negotiate almost every aspect of the game, you'll need to work with other players to get what you need, whether it's delivering messages, obtaining privileges, or trading goods. As you move through the city, you'll use a combination of auctioning, bribery, and trading to get ahead. With 2 to 5 players and a playtime of 60 to 120 minutes, Genoa is a game that requires strategy and social skill. Designed by Rüdiger Dorn and first published in 2001, this game has stood the test of time, offering a unique and engaging experience for fans of negotiation and Renaissance-themed games.
